public function testAccessDeniedCompany()
 {
     $user = factory(\App\Entities\User::class)->create();
     $user->setUp();
     $this->actingAs($user);
     $this->visit('/model/1/edit');
     $this->see(Lang::get('general.accessdenied'));
     $model = Model::find(1);
     $model->vehicles()->delete();
     $this->visit('/model/destroy/1');
     $this->see(Lang::get('general.accessdenied'));
 }
 public function testDelete()
 {
     $idDelete = Model::all()->last()['id'];
     factory(\App\Entities\Vehicle::class)->create(['model_vehicle_id' => $idDelete]);
     $this->seeInDatabase('models', ['id' => $idDelete]);
     $this->visit('/model/destroy/' . $idDelete)->seePageIs('/model')->see('Este registro possui refer');
     $this->seeIsNotSoftDeletedInDatabase('models', ['id' => $idDelete]);
     $model = Model::find($idDelete);
     $model->vehicles()->delete();
     $this->seeInDatabase('models', ['id' => $idDelete]);
     $this->visit('/model/destroy/' . $idDelete);
     $this->seeIsSoftDeletedInDatabase('models', ['id' => $idDelete]);
 }